Building Your Instruction Library [CG-07]
You don’t need to rewrite instructions from scratch each time.
A small instruction library gives you reusable building blocks.
💡Keep a few core blocks:
A tone block, a formatting block, and a “how to ask clarifying questions” block.
Add specialized blocks for tasks you perform often, like planning, outlining, or rewriting.
Over time, this becomes a source of consistency.
You assemble GPTs instead of drafting them.
The quality stays stable because the building blocks stay stable.
An instruction library turns GPT creation into a repeatable system, not a fresh effort.
